#961c56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#961c56 is composed of 58.8% red, 11%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.3% magenta, 42.7%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 331.5 degrees, a saturation of 68.5% and a lightness of 34.9%. #961c56 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ff38ac with #2d0000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#961c56 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#961c56 has RGB values of R:150, G:28,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.43,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9837654.

Shades and Tints of #961c56
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#fcf0f6 is the lightest one.
